    摘要: An ink jet recording apparatus for effecting recording with ink that adheres to a recording medium has an ink jet recording head unit having a recording head in which a plurality of electrothermal conversion elements available to discharge the ink are arranged, a heat exchange device having a first heat exchange portion contacting with the whole area of one side of the recording head in the lengthwise direction thereof and effecting heat exchange and a second heat exchange portion provided in continuation to the first heat exchange portion and extending on the outside far from the recording head, a heater provided near the second heat exchange portion for heating the heat exchange device, and a temperature detector provided on a portion of the first heat exchange portion; the second heat exchange portion being inclined upwardly relative to the recording head; a cooling device for acting on the second heat exchange portion of the heat exchange device and assisting the heat radiation of the second heat exchange portion; and drive controller for controlling the driving of the cooling device and/or the heating device on the basis of the temperature detected by the temperature detector.

    摘要: A solenoid valve comprises a housing including an inlet port for fluid communication with a positive pressure source and an outlet port for fluid communication with a negative pressure source; a passage for fluid communication between the inlet port and the outlet port; and an axially bi-directional solenoid-actuated valve in the housing for opening and closing the passage, including an electromagnetically movable valve member having a sealing area exposed to the negative pressure from the outlet port when the valve means is in the closed position; and a diaphragm defining a back pressure chamber in fluid communication with the passage for offsetting the effect of the negative pressure on the exposed sealing area and reducing the electromagnetic force required to move the valve member.

    摘要: A power supply apparatus includes a power supply mechanism which supplies, from an external power supply, electric power to be supplied to an electrostatic chuck. The power supply mechanism includes a first conductive annular member fixed to the end portion of a strut, and capable of rotating together with the strut, a second conductive annular member fixed to a housing, and brought into surface contact with the first conductive annular member, and a first power supply member which supplies a supplied first voltage to an electrode of the electrostatic chuck via the second conductive annular member and the first conductive annular member.

    摘要: Analysis is made on the DNA methylation of the region (including a promoter region) upstream from the translation initiation point of a rheumatoid arthritis-associated gene DR3 in human genome. As a result, it is found out that an allele-specific methylation occurs in a CpG sequence located about −380 to −180 bp upstream from translation initiation point (ATG) of the gene DR3. It is further found out that the CpG sequences downstream therefrom of the genes DR3 originating in healthy subjects are all in the unmethylated state, while methylated and unmethylated sequences are both observed in the genes DR3 originating in RA patients.

    摘要: A rotary solenoid for stabilizing performance is provided. A rotary solenoid 10 includes a pair of the first yoke 21 and the second yoke 22 placed oppositely in a rotor 24 providing a pair of magnetic poles by a permanent magnet, a core 23 enclosed by the first yoke 21 and the second yoke 22, and a coil 25 wound around the core 23 and forming a pair of magnetic poles in the first yoke 21 and the second yoke 22 by supplying electricity. These first yoke 21, second yoke 22, core 23, and coil 25 are resin-molded. A projecting portion 26a is provided in an outer surface on the opposite side of enclosing the core 23 by the first yoke 21 and the second yoke 22.

    摘要: A printing apparatus and an ink-discharge status detection method which perform appropriate print control by detecting discharge failure with a simple construction, without reducing the printing speed. The apparatus, to which the method is applied, performs test ink discharge from a part of nozzles of a printhead while scanning the printhead, and detects ink discharge statuses of the nozzles of the printhead by using a photosensor in an area between the home position of the printhead and a position outside of an effective printing area. In next detection, nozzles different from those used in the previous test ink discharge are used for performing test ink discharge, and discharge statuses are detected. Discharge statuses of all the nozzles are detected in forward and backward scannings or a plurality of scannings.

    摘要: An ink-jet printed product is formed by printing an image with a plurality of similar color inks having different concentrations and a special ink having a single concentration. In the product, graininess resulting from ink dots is decreased for all hues of the printed image. A decision is made as to whether or not a hue of an image to be printed can be printed with inks without the special ink of a color (for example, special color BL (blue)) having a single concentration. When it is decided that the hue of the image is to be printed with inks without the special color ink, data on ink color BL (blue) is decomposed into data on C (cyan) and data on M (magenta). The hue can be printed without the color BL, thereby significantly decreasing graininess in a portion having this hue.

    摘要: A liquid ejecting apparatus, such as an ink-jet printing apparatus includes a blade for wiping a surface of a liquid ejecting head for ejecting a liquid and a device for cleaning the blade with achieving expansion of life and permitting efficient process. The apparatus achieves reduction of frequency of scrubbing contact between the blade and the liquid ejecting surface and high efficiency in recovery process associated with wiping operation and so forth. Also, by providing a washing liquid for the blade upon termination of printing, the blade may be maintained in sufficiently wetted condition.
